Corporate service providers face a challenge that traditional Workday implementations are rarely designed to solve: preserving customer-specific security, business processes, approval chains, and reporting while keeping the platform administrable, governable, and efficient at the provider level. Standard shared-service configurations often collapse under that weight, forcing either rigid standardization or unmanageable sprawl.

Our approach prioritizes all three dimensions simultaneously: each customer operates within a clearly segmented context with appropriate isolation and independence; the provider retains a clean, consolidated view for administration, reporting, and governance; and the architecture is designed to absorb new customers without rebuilding what already works.

Customer Segmentation & Security Architecture

Leverage Workday organizations, custom organizations, and security domain frameworks to create distinct operating environments for each customer within a single tenant, with clear data separation and access controls.

Customer-Specific Business Process Frameworks

Configure Workday business processes to route, approve, and execute differently by customer, supporting unique organizational structures, approval hierarchies, compliance obligations, and service delivery requirements.

Scalable Onboarding & Offboarding

Build repeatable methodologies for adding new customers to the platform and transitioning departing clients off cleanly, minimizing disruption to existing operations and accelerating time-to-value for each new engagement.

Customer-Specific Reporting & Analytics

Design reporting frameworks that deliver each customer a view of only their data with metrics, formats, and delivery mechanisms aligned to their specific needs, while the provider retains a consolidated operational view across all customers.

Integration Architecture & Management

Design and maintain integrations that connect each customer's external systems to Workday without cross-contamination, supporting payroll, benefits, financial, and operational integration requirements across diverse client environments.

Tenant Governance & Release Management

Establish governance models that manage configuration changes, Workday releases, security updates, and enhancement requests across a shared tenant, ensuring platform stability while continuing to meet evolving customer requirements.

Managing Complex Financial Structures Across Entities

Workday Financials supports the multi-entity complexity that corporate service providers manage on behalf of clients and within their own organizational structures, from consolidated reporting and intercompany transactions to accounts payable automation and audit-ready financial records.

Multi-Entity Financial Management & Intercompany Eliminations

Structure multiple legal entities, cost centers, and reporting hierarchies within Workday with automated intercompany transaction management and elimination workflows that support consolidated and entity-level financial reporting.

Accounts Payable & Receivable Automation

Streamline invoice processing, payment approvals, and cash application across complex organizational structures. Reduce manual reconciliation and maintain a complete audit trail for financial operations across entities.

Financial Planning & Scenario Modeling

Connect operational headcount and compensation data to financial plans using Workday Adaptive Planning. Build driver-based financial models, run scenario analyses, and give finance and leadership a shared platform for budget and forecast management.

Expense Management & Policy Controls

Configure expense report workflows, corporate card reconciliation, and spending policy controls across business units and entities. Automate policy enforcement and generate spend analytics that surface compliance gaps and cost reduction opportunities.
